Transaction 66adf72469b256fb7a947d9f115c03d22f8d2e9cb5ee0dcea1f5c4311ee8e9b2

1 Input
2 Outputs
  • 66adf72469b256fb7a947d9f115c03d22f8d2e9cb5ee0dcea1f5c4311ee8e9b2:0
  • value  436921
    address  34zvqtfUw5zB1HJk63GCb7rMoJohvs3MSw
  • 66adf72469b256fb7a947d9f115c03d22f8d2e9cb5ee0dcea1f5c4311ee8e9b2:1
  • value  554710706
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V